Alderwood Mall Parkway Pedestrian Improvements

Description - Completed Summer 2020

Snohomish County Public Works filled in two sidewalk gaps on the east side of Alderwood Mall Parkway between 164th St SW and 168th St SW. The combined length of the new sidewalks is approximately 220 feet. New shoulder, curb, gutter, sidewalks, planter strips, drainage facilities, and retaining walls was also constructed as part of the project. Other improvements include re-striping the roadway to add a northbound travel lane and improve associated ADA facilities where needed.

Schedule

Construction on this project began in March 2020 and was completed by summer 2020.

Environmental Review

An environmental review and right-of-way acquisitions have been completed for this project. 

Funding

This project is funded by the Snohomish County Road Fund.
